What is Chemical Waste?

Hazardous chemical waste may be generated from laboratory processes, facilities operations and maintenance, construction and renovation activities, photo processing etc. Chemical waste is considered hazardous if poses a hazard to human health or the environment when improperly managed. Examples of Chemical Waste are as follows, but not limited to,

  • By-products generated from research laboratories
  • Unused and surplus reagent-grade chemicals
  • Batteries
  • Anything contaminated by chemicals
  • Used oil of all types
  • Spent solvents - including water-based
  • Mercury containing items
  • Photographic film processing solutions and chemicals
  • Pesticides
  • Non-returnable gas cylinders
  • Non-empty aerosol cans
  • Chemically contaminated sharps
  • Finely divided powders
  • Contaminated syringes, needles, blades etc
  • Equipment and apparatus containing hazardous waste
  • Computer/electronic equipment
  • Toner cartridges
  • Ethylene glycol
  • Paints - both oil and latex
  • Fluorescent light bulbs
  • Light ballasts
  • Preserved specimens
  • Custodial and industrial cleaners
  • Uncured Resins(Phenolic, Epoxy, Styrene, etc....)
  • Dye and glazes
  • Degreasing solvents
  • Brake/Transmission/Power Steering Fluids

Labelling of Chemical waste:

All chemical waste containers must be labelled clearly to identify their contents. The following details must be included on the waste label:

  1. Name of the person responsible for the waste 
  2. Description of waste details
  3. Date of generation

Chemical waste is treated based on its physical and chemical properties. Waste is segregated properly to avoid the mixing of incompatible materials in waste streams. This, in turn, can cause unwanted reactions, such as the production of toxic gases or explosions and risk the lives of everyone in the area.



For this, there are several proven treatment methods and technologies available including rotary kiln incineration, Physico-chemical treatment, enhanced plasma system, special recovery processes, mining, refining, electrolysis, etc. 

1. Disposal Through Chemical Treatment:

Chemical treatment involves the complete breakdown of hazardous waste into less dangerous non-toxic gases. Frequently, the chemical process transforms hazardous waste into less toxic substances, that can be extracted to form a solution.



These methods include the ion exchange reaction, chemical precipitation, oxidation and reduction (a.k.a. redox) reaction, Neutralisation etc.



Often, chemical treatments are coupled with physical treatment methods to achieve the desired results. In some cases, coagulants are used along with physical flocculation techniques to expedite the process.

2. Disposal Through Physical Treatment Methods:

Physical treatments use filters where contaminated wastewater is passed over activated carbon or resin to remove pollutants. Other treatments may use gravitational methods to separate materials from solutions by sedimentation. In addition, Phase change systems are another physical treatment method that captures waste to create a solid mass.

3. Disposal Through Thermal Treatment Methods:

The most common form of thermal treatment is the high-temperature incineration method. In today’s world, thermal treatment is considered the most preferred option for treating hazardous waste. As it is well suited to certain types of waste, such as waste aqueous solvent blends, drilling mud, mining sludge and some tars.



Heavy metals wastes should never be incinerated, as these metals remain in the incinerator ash, and pose a health hazard. Therefore, requires special disposal. The pyrolysis technique is also employed to dispose of hazardous materials through heating.

4. Disposal Through Biological Treatment Methods

Biological disposal of chemical wastes primarily uses microorganisms like bacteria. Bacteria can seamlessly degrade organic compounds in wastewater streams, and convert the biodegradable organic matter into simpler substances and biomass.



Bioremediation is another popular and effective biological treatment for treating wastewater.



Landfilling is a bioremediation technique used to treat contaminated soils by various methods.
